MEMO — Branch Managers

The Varnell Logistics supply contract expires at quarter-end. We will renew for 18 months at revised rates; freight surcharges drop 2%. No action needed at branch level until new terms circulate next week. Direct questions to regional ops, not to Varnell reps. Keep this internal. The confidential note below covers our position:

board note of bawep-tajef: Queniusek Systems plans to raise the Quenvan list price by 53.1 percent in March. The pricing group signed off on a budget of $176.4 million for Project Drueth. The renewal with Casionix Partners closes at $142.5 million a year, 8.3 percent below the last contract. Project Fraax slips by six weeks because of the tooling delay.

Subject: Quickstore 4.2 — bloom filter now fronts the KV layer

Plugin authors: starting with this release, Quickstore places a bloom filter ahead of the key-value store. Negative lookups return faster; false positives fall through safely. No API changes are required on your side. Verify your plugin against the staging build referenced below.

session token of fahif-tadup = htk3_9c7

// Crash-report pipeline constants (Pebblewing ingest tier).
// Reports arrive from the Lanternfall mobile SDK in gzipped batches;
// we debounce duplicate stack hashes before forwarding to triage.
// Reviewers: the retry window must stay shorter than the SDK's
// client-side resend interval or we double-count crashes. Queue
// depth caps were sized against the worst spike we saw during the
// Marrowgate launch. Do not raise batch size without re-running the
// dedupe soak test. The tuning constants are defined immediately below.

constants for kawef-bawif:
TIERS = {
    "oliir": 236,
    "lamion": 438,
    "pelmir": 279,
}

## Changelog — Font vendoring defaults changed

As of this release, the Bracken UI build no longer fetches third-party fonts at build time. All typefaces used by the Lanternwell suite are now vendored into the repo under a dedicated assets directory, and the fetch step is skipped by default. If you're onboarding, nothing to install — the fonts travel with the checkout. The build flags controlling this behavior are listed below.

settings of hadup-yafog:
LAMAEL_PIN=3761
LAMAEL_TENANT=istmir
LAMAEL_METRICS_HOST=metrics.lamael.plorvasys.test
LAMAEL_SEAL=seal_8ea68500
LAMAEL_STANDBY_TEAM=fraok